Output fcbf8a25d23840dfde05e8e96616467ab75436b3b11e833c426eeef5bc525fb5:0

value
70000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8db4cb74b2f171add221a08718443a411df6b20d OP_EQUAL
address
3EcHnRy1BqiwmVUyzmJTSqnRduFx4SturX
transaction
fcbf8a25d23840dfde05e8e96616467ab75436b3b11e833c426eeef5bc525fb5
spent
true